Chili

Chili is a classic comfort meal, and we couldn’t leave it off this list of yummy recipes. Using ground turkey instead of beef is a great way to make this meal heart healthy. If you’re looking for a new and exciting take on a traditional chili recipe, try switching out the ground meat for sweet potato!

Ingredients

1 can diced tomatoes

1 can tomato sauce

1 can kidney beans

1 pound ground beef or turkey

1 packet chili seasoning

  1. Brown ground meat
  2. Drain meat and add to crockpot
  3. Combine other ingredients
  4. Cook on low heat for at least 4 hours

Pot roast with green beans

Everyone needs a mindless dinner recipe for days that are more challenging than others. This one-step process lets you spend more time relaxing on the nights that you need it.

Ingredients

2 pounds frozen boneless chuck

1 pound frozen green beans

1 packet onion soup mix

1 cup water

  1. Combine ingredients in crockpot and cook on low heat for 8 hours

Chicken and dumplings

What’s more comforting than chicken and dumplings? Knowing that you can make it in a crockpot whenever you want it!

Ingredients

2 pounds boneless, skinless chicken breasts

1 bag frozen mixed veggies

1 onion

1 can cream of chicken soup

1 can chicken broth

1 canned biscuits

1 teaspoon garlic salt and poultry seasoning

  1. Combine chicken and veggies in crockpot
  2. Add in cream of chicken soup, broth, and seasonings
  3. Cook on low heat for 6 hours or high heat for 3
  4. Remove and shred chicken
  5. Re-add chicken and cut-up biscuits
  6. Cook on high heat for 60-90 minutes, stirring occasionally

Pulled pork

This recipe is a take on cocktail meatballs but is heartier and can be made into a sandwich and paired with pre-made sides like potato salad and coleslaw!

Ingredients

2 pounds bone-in pork shoulder

1 cup grape jelly

1 cup ketchup

¼ teaspoon ground allspice

  1. Add pork to crockpot
  2. Combine jelly, ketchup, and allspice and pour over pork
  3. Cook on low heat for 8-12 hours
  4. Remove pork and separate meat from bone

Lemon chicken and rice

While we’re all for the comfort meals, sometimes you need something a bit lighter. This meal is not only delicious but is full of nutrients, making it a great option for a healthy, fulfilling dinner.

Ingredients

2 cups white rice and water

3 tablespoons butter

1 pound chicken breasts

½ cup lemon juice

1 teaspoon garlic

  1. Combine rice, water, and butter in slow cooker
  2. Place sliced chicken on top of rice and add lemon juice and garlic
  3. Cover and cook on low heat for 6-8 hours
